首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

如何超链接到我的Web应用程序中不存在的文件?

要在您的Web应用程序中创建指向不存在的文件的超链接,您可以使用JavaScript来实现。以下是一个简单的示例:

  1. 首先,在您的HTML文件中添加一个超链接,并为其指定一个ID,以便稍后在JavaScript中引用。
代码语言:html
复制
<a id="download-link" href="#">点击下载</a>
  1. 接下来,在HTML文件中添加JavaScript代码,以便在用户点击超链接时创建一个新的文件下载。
代码语言:html<script>
复制
  document.getElementById('download-link').addEventListener('click', function(event) {
    event.preventDefault();

    // 创建一个新的Blob对象,其中包含您想要下载的文件内容
    var fileContent = '这是一个示例文件内容';
    var blob = new Blob([fileContent], { type: 'text/plain' });

    // 创建一个URL,以便在超链接中使用
    var url = URL.createObjectURL(blob);

    // 创建一个隐藏的HTML下载链接元素
    var downloadLink = document.createElement('a');
    downloadLink.href = url;
    downloadLink.download = '示例文件.txt';

    // 将下载链接添加到文档中,并触发点击事件
    document.body.appendChild(downloadLink);
    downloadLink.click();

    // 移除下载链接,并释放URL对象
    document.body.removeChild(downloadLink);
    URL.revokeObjectURL(url);
  });
</script>

这个示例将在用户点击超链接时创建一个名为“示例文件.txt”的文件,其中包含一些示例文本。您可以根据需要修改文件内容和文件名。

请注意,这个方法仅适用于客户端JavaScript,不需要服务器端处理。如果您需要在服务器端生成文件,请考虑使用后端编程语言(如Node.js、Python、PHP等)来实现。

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

5分50秒

19_尚硅谷_MyBatis_思考:映射文件中的SQL该如何拼接

1分45秒

Elastic-5分钟教程:如何为你的搜索应用设置同义词

2分59秒

Elastic 5分钟教程:使用机器学习,自动化异常检测

3分7秒

MySQL系列九之【文件管理】

3分40秒

Elastic 5分钟教程:使用Trace了解和调试应用程序

7分1秒

Split端口详解

6分28秒

15-Vite中使用WebWorker

1分51秒

Ranorex Studio简介

36秒

PS使用教程:如何在Mac版Photoshop中画出对称的图案?

7分53秒

EDI Email Send 与 Email Receive端口

8分29秒

16-Vite中引入WebAssembly

22秒

PS使用教程:如何在Mac版Photoshop中新建A4纸?

领券